Executive Summary

PolyPid Ltd. Ordinary Shares (PYPD) recently released its the previous quarter earnings results, marking the latest public financial disclosure for the clinical-stage biopharmaceutical firm. The reported metrics for the quarter include an earnings per share (EPS) figure of -0.41, with no revenue recorded during the three-month period. Management Commentary

During the associated earnings call, PYPD leadership focused the majority of their discussion on operational progress rather than quarterly financial figures, given the company’s current development stage. Management noted that the negative EPS for the previous quarter was driven primarily by investments in late-stage clinical trials for the company’s lead long-acting drug delivery candidate, as well as costs associated with preparing for potential future regulatory submissions in key global markets. Leadership confirmed that the absence of revenue in the quarter was expected, as the company has not yet launched any commercial products, and no licensing partnership agreements that would generate milestone or royalty revenue were finalized during the period. Management also noted that operating expenses for the quarter were in line with internal budget projections, with no unplanned spending events impacting the quarterly results. Leadership also addressed questions around cash burn rates, noting that spending priorities for the period were aligned with long-term pipeline advancement goals. Forward Guidance

PYPD management did not provide specific quantitative financial guidance for future periods during the earnings call, citing the inherent uncertainty of clinical development timelines and regulatory approval processes as key factors limiting the predictability of near-term financial results. Leadership did note that they expect operating spending to remain at roughly comparable levels in the coming months as the company advances its lead candidate through remaining clinical milestones, and that they believe current cash reserves are sufficient to cover planned operational costs for the foreseeable future. Management also noted that any potential future revenue would be tied to either successful regulatory approval and commercial launch of lead pipeline assets, or the execution of strategic collaboration agreements with larger pharmaceutical partners, both of which are contingent on upcoming clinical readouts that carry inherent risk of delay or failure. Market Reaction

Following the release of the previous quarter earnings, trading activity in PYPD shares remained within normal volume ranges in recent sessions, with limited immediate price volatility observed. Analysts covering the firm noted that the reported EPS figure and lack of revenue were largely in line with consensus market expectations, leading to minimal surprise among institutional investors and retail stakeholders. Most analyst notes published after the earnings release emphasized that investor sentiment toward PYPD is currently tied almost entirely to upcoming clinical trial outcomes and regulatory progress, rather than quarterly operating loss figures, which are considered par for the course for pre-commercial biotech firms of similar size and development stage. Some market observers have noted that positive updates on pipeline progress could potentially drive shifts in trading activity for PYPD in the upcoming months, though any such moves would be dependent on the outcome of those still-unresolved development milestones.
